Tesseract and Beyond: Exploring Higher Dimensional Spaces

The concept of dimensionality reaches beyond our everyday perception of three spatial dimensions. While we navigate a world defined by length, width, and height, mathematicians and physicists probe into realms of four or even higher dimensions. The tesseract, a four-dimensional cube, serves as a remarkable example of this, offering glimpses into extraordinary spatial configurations.

Visualizing these higher dimensions poses a significant challenge, as our brains are hardwired to process only three. Yet, conceptual models and simulations enable us to comprehend the complexities of these multidimensional spaces.
